Key Market Indicators
Exports of Indian musical instruments are projected to reach around $22 million by 2026, up 1.5% annually from $20 million in 2021. This growth rate has been consistent since 1993, rising 2.8% per year. India ranked 26th in 2021, with Slovakia overtaking them at $20 million. Germany, the United States and Japan were the top three countries in this ranking. Imports of Indian musical instruments are estimated to reach $76 million by 2026, up 3.3% annually from $62 million in 2021. This rate of growth has been increasing since 1993, with a 10.6% rise each year. In 2021, India ranked 24th, with Mexico overtaking them at $62 million. Germany, China and Japan were the top three countries on this list.
